To bolt a Turbo 400 transmission to an LS1 Chevy engine, you'll need a specific adapter plate or bellhousing designed for LS engines and Turbo 400 transmissions, as they have different bolt patterns. First, ensure that the engine and transmission are both clean and free of debris. Align the adapter plate with the engine's bolt holes, then secure it using the appropriate bolts. Finally, attach the Turbo 400 to the adapter plate, ensuring all bolts are tightened to the manufacturer's specifications.
To remove the turbo from a Citroën Picasso diesel engine, first ensure the vehicle is securely lifted and supported. Disconnect the battery, then remove any components obstructing access to the turbo, such as the intake pipe and exhaust manifold. Detach the oil feed and return lines, and unbolt the turbo from the engine block. Finally, carefully lift the turbo out of its housing, ensuring no debris falls into the engine.
Yes, the Turbo 400 will bolt up to the 305. Use the original Turbo 400 torque converter and flex plate unless the 305 flex plate has dual bolt pattern to except the 400 converter.
